Explore a lecture on specific instances of the Abhyankar-Sathaye Conjecture presented by Neena Gupta at the Inaugural Meeting of Asian-Oceanian Women in Mathematics. Delve into this 38-minute talk, which was part of a hybrid discussion meeting organized by the International Centre for Theoretical Sciences. Gain insights into this mathematical concept as explained by a distinguished researcher in the field. Learn about the efforts to promote and support women in mathematics across the Asian-Oceanian region through this inaugural event, which aimed to facilitate interactions, provide a platform for sharing concerns, and highlight achievements of women mathematicians.
